The North Dakota Legislature is gearing up for the 2009 legislative session, which will occur mostly in the first quarter of the year.  A three-day organizational session begins today (December 1, 2008).  Items on the agenda include everything from where the legislators will sit to the presentation of the Governor’s budget on December 3. 

Information about the 61st legislative session and this brief organizational session can be found at the North Dakota Legislative Branch web site.
